  • What sports or outdoor activites can visitors enjoy in and around Dungannon?

    Dungannon offers a variety of sports and outdoor activities. You could try your hand at golf at the Dungannon Golf Club, or enjoy a game of tennis at the local courts. If you're looking for something more adventurous, you could go fishing on Lough Neagh, or try kayaking on the River Blackwater.

  • What other towns or cities can be easily accessed from Dungannon?

    Dungannon is well-connected to other towns and cities in Northern Ireland. You can easily reach the city of Armagh, which is home to the Armagh Observatory and Planetarium, or the historic city of Derry/Londonderry, which is known for its city walls and its rich history.

  • What are the local dishes in Dungannon region?

    The local cuisine in Dungannon is heavily influenced by Irish tradition. You can try classic dishes like Irish stew, soda bread, and boxty, which is a potato pancake. The area is also known for its fresh seafood, so you can find plenty of restaurants serving dishes like cod and chips, or salmon with seasonal vegetables.
